Woolly Bugger Olive
Step into the waters with the timeless allure of the Woolly Bugger, an essential addition to any angler's fly collection. This versatile streamer has earned its reputation as a staple in the fly fishing world due to its unmatched adaptability and effectiveness in both still and moving waters. Its marabou tail, combined with a palmered hackle, imitates a plethora of aquatic life – from small baitfish to large insect nymphs and even leeches.
